The Mechanics of Sofa Damage and Loss
Sofas are vulnerable to various types of damage, including water stains, fires, mold growth, and physical destruction. Understanding the common causes of sofa damage can help you take preventative measures to protect your investment. From leaks and floods to electrical malfunctions and accidental fires, knowing how to mitigate these risks is essential for safeguarding your sofa.
Top 5 Causes of Sofa Damage:
- Water damage due to leaks, floods, or condensation
- Fires caused by electrical malfunctions, candles, or smoking
- Mold growth from high humidity, poor ventilation, or water damage
- Physical damage from pets, children, or accidents

Opportunities for Renters:
- Work with your landlord to implement preventative measures and emergency response plans
- Document your sofa's condition before moving in and take photos or videos as evidence
- Invest in renter's insurance to cover losses in case of an accident or disaster
- Choose a sofa with a removable cover or stain-resistant fabric to make maintenance easier
